  82. /**
  83. * Create an entry for this application in the system account list, if it isn't already there.
  84. *
  85. * @param context Context
  86. */
  87. public static void CreateSyncAccount(Context context) {
  88. boolean newAccount = false;
  89. boolean setupComplete = PreferenceManager
  90. .getDefaultSharedPreferences(context).getBoolean(PREF_SETUP_COMPLETE, false);
  91. // Create account, if it's missing. (Either first run, or user has deleted account.)
  92. Account account = HostageAccountService.GetAccount();
  93. AccountManager accountManager = (AccountManager) context.getSystemService(Context.ACCOUNT_SERVICE);
  94. if (accountManager.addAccountExplicitly(account, null, null)) {
  95. // Inform the system that this account supports sync
  96. ContentResolver.setIsSyncable(account, CONTENT_AUTHORITY, 1);
  97. // Inform the system that this account is eligible for auto sync when the network is up
  98. ContentResolver.setSyncAutomatically(account, CONTENT_AUTHORITY, true);
  99. // Recommend a schedule for automatic synchronization. The system may modify this based
  100. // on other scheduled syncs and network utilization.
  101. ContentResolver.addPeriodicSync(
  102. account, CONTENT_AUTHORITY, new Bundle(),SYNC_FREQUENCY);
  103. newAccount = true;
  104. }
  105. // Schedule an initial sync if we detect problems with either our account or our local
  106. // data has been deleted. (Note that it's possible to clear app data WITHOUT affecting
  107. // the account list, so wee need to check both.)
  108. if (newAccount || !setupComplete) {
  109. TriggerRefresh();
  110. PreferenceManager.getDefaultSharedPreferences(context).edit()
  111. .putBoolean(PREF_SETUP_COMPLETE, true).commit();
  112. }
  113. }
  114. public static void TriggerRefresh() {
  115. Bundle b = new Bundle();
  116. // Disable sync backoff and ignore sync preferences. In other words...perform sync NOW!
  117. b.putBoolean(ContentResolver.SYNC_EXTRAS_MANUAL, true);
  118. b.putBoolean(ContentResolver.SYNC_EXTRAS_EXPEDITED, true);
  119. ContentResolver.requestSync(
  120. HostageAccountService.GetAccount(), // Sync account
  121. CONTENT_AUTHORITY, // Content authority
  122. b); // Extras
  123. }
